Which version of dhtmlxFolders you are using?
( there was issue related to your situation in dhtmlxFolders 1.6, which was resolved in 2.0 version )

>>I am guessing this might come from the xsl file
The same xsl file works without any errors in case of local samples.
Please be sure
a) you have not any extra whitespaces in code of podcast.xsl before <xsl:stylesheet
b) server configured to send xsl files with correct content type ( application/xml or text/xml )

>>What might be the problem here?
Normally such situation occurs if you are using incorrect XSL file
